Albumin Versus Hydroxyethyl Starch in Cardiopulmonary Bypass Surgery

Comparing the effects of 5% albumin and 6% hydroxyethyl starch 130/0.4 on glomerular filtration rate and serum creatinine when used as priming solutions for cardiopulmonary bypass pump.

Inclusion criteria

Inclusion criteria: Inclusion criteria: patients undergoing elective coronary artery bypass grafting; age between 30 - 60 . Exclusion criteria: chronic renal failure; cardiopulmonary by pass pomp time over 2 hours; Patients were underwent an emergency operation; infective endocarditis; preoperative coagulation disorder; liver insufficiency; a left ventricular ejection fraction of less than 50%; previous cardiac surgery; a hemoglobin level of less than 10 milligram per deciliter before surgery.

Design outcomes

Primary

MeasureTime frame
Serum Creatinine. Timepoint: preoprative and every 24 houre to 72 hour postoperatively. Method of measurement: isotope dilution mass spectrometry.

Secondary

MeasureTime frame
Glomerular filtration rate. Timepoint: preoperative and Every 24 hour to 72 hour postoperatively. Method of measurement: isotope dilution mass spectrometry.
